Black and tan bedroom walls can be a fantastic choice for creating a cozy, sophisticated space!
Here are some pros and cons to consider:
**Pros:**
1. **Timeless elegance**: The classic combination of black and tan is a timeless choice that can never go out of style.
2. **Adds depth**: The contrast between the dark and light colors creates visual interest and adds depth to the room.
3. **Creates coziness**: Black walls can make the space feel cozier, while the tan trim and accents can add warmth and energy.
4. **Versatile**: This color combination works well with a variety of furniture styles, from modern to traditional.
**Cons:**
1. **Darkness**: If not balanced correctly, black walls can make the room feel dark and cave-like.
2. **Overwhelming**: The strong contrast between black and tan might be overwhelming for some people's taste.
3. **Difficult to match**: Choosing furniture and accessories that complement this bold color combination can be challenging.
**Tips to make it work:**
1. **Balance with light**: Make sure to balance the dark walls with lighter elements, such as bedding, curtains, or a statement piece of furniture.
2. **Use warm accents**: Add warmth with tan or golden accents, like throw pillows, blankets, or a wood headboard.
3. **Choose a neutral bedframe**: A neutral-colored bedframe can help tie the room together and provide a calm contrast to the bold walls.

A black and tan bedroom paint scheme can be a great choice for creating a cozy, sophisticated space. Here are some tips to consider:
**Benefits:**
1. **Contrast:** The combination of dark and light colors creates visual interest and adds depth to the room.
2. **Warmth:** Tan or beige tones can bring warmth and coziness to the space, making it perfect for a bedroom retreat.
3. **Flexibility:** Black and tan paint colors can work well with various decorating styles, from traditional to modern.
**Color Palette:**
1. **Black:** Use a rich, dark gray or navy blue instead of pure black if you prefer a softer look.
2. **Tan:** Choose a warm beige, golden brown, or honey-colored shade for a cozy and inviting atmosphere.
3. **Accent Colors:** Add pops of white, cream, or light wood tones to balance the space and prevent it from feeling too heavy.
**Design Considerations:**
1. **Balance:** Ensure that both colors are used in harmony, with no one color dominating the other. You can achieve this by painting one wall black and the others tan, or using a black accent wall with tan furniture.
2. **Lighting:** Since dark colors can make a room feel darker, use table lamps or floor lamps to create pools of light and add warmth.
3. **Furniture:** Select furniture pieces that complement the color scheme, such as dark wood or metal frames with tan upholstery.
**Tips for Implementation:**
1. **Start with the walls:** Paint the ceiling and walls in the black and tan color scheme, then use a lighter shade on the trim to create contrast.
2. **Use it wisely:** Apply the darker color (black) to smaller areas like accent walls or furniture pieces to avoid overwhelming the space.
3. **Add texture:** Incorporate textiles with different textures and patterns to add visual interest and break up the solid colors.
Remember, when working with a bold color combination like black and tan, it's essential to balance the design to create a harmonious and inviting atmosphere.
